Energy, Resources and Environment | M.A. Requirements 2013-14 (entering class)

Concentration

Students concentrating in Energy, Resources and Environment must take at least four courses within the program – only one course may be cross-listed. In addition, all students must successfully complete the Online Basics of Energy course (within the first three weeks of their first term). Three courses must have an ERE course number (SA.680.XXX). At minimum, one course must be designated as an “Energy" course, and one course must be designated as an “Environment” course. Refer to the ERE Curriculum matrix in the Prospectus for course designations.
  
Equivalency for Bologna Students
To fulfill their energy course requirement, students initiating their studies in Bologna may take either SA.680.756 "Politics and Economics of International Energy" or SA.680.781 "Renewable Energy: Markets, Technologies & Projects" at the SAIS Bologna Campus OR take an energy-designated course upon arrival at the SAIS Washington Campus. To fulfill the environment course requirement, Bologna students should take SA.680.722 "Energy and Climate Change." A Bologna student may elect to substitute an equivalent energy-designated or environment-designated course in Washington for the Bologna courses. Refer to the ERE Curriculum matrix for a listing of ERE courses and designations.

International Relations

Students also must fulfill the general requirements for the field of International Relations, that is, an additional two courses within IR, including courses from two programs other than Energy, Resources and Environment.*

International Economics

All candidates for the M.A. degree must complete a concentration in the field of International Economics by taking four to six economics courses at SAIS. Students can also pursue a specialization within International Economics by taking additional course work.

Core Courses

All SAIS students must pass two core exams and/or courses. Energy, Resources and Environment concentrators must pass Theories of International Relations as one of their core requirements prior to the start of their third semester. If the other core is not completed by the start of his/her final semester, the student must enroll in a core course.

Language Proficiency

M.A. candidates must pass exams to demonstrate proficiency in a language taught at SAIS other than their native language. International students whose native language is not English may use English as their proficiency language. All non-native English speakers are required to pass an English placement exam upon entering SAIS.

Capstone

Energy, Resources and Environment concentrators must complete ONE of the following capstones: 1. Energy, Resources and Environment Oral Exam 2. M.A. Oral Exam (to compete for honors—if eligible) *International Relations concentrators studying at the Bologna Center must take at least three IR courses in Washington. Exception: Those concentrators who are dual-degree students or have advanced standing must take at least two IR courses in Washington. A total of 16 courses taken for credit are required for an M.A. degree (unless a student has advanced standing or is in a dual-degree program).
